At the Introductory Level, ball-handling and dribbling take on the most basic form, allowing players to become familiar with the basketball. Players who have become acquainted with the basketball are able to hold and move the basketball correctly. As soon as this occurs at the Introductory Level, it is important to introduce the concept of proper basketball positioning.

Every aspect of basketball, from an offensive standpoint, centers around this stance. Begin by teaching players how to dribble in a linear path. To make sure players are traveling in a straight line, coaches may use the painted lines on a gymnasium floor. If players keep their hands directly on top of the basketball, the basketball will not travel with them.

Exploration will help players become familiar and comfortable with proper hand placement as they progress. Further, players should be encouraged to keep the basketball at or below waist level while dribbling. Practice makes perfect. If you're a little overwhelmed by the controls above, don't panic. The more you play, the better your muscle memory, but if you need a little extra time to get accustomed to the various combos, head to the Practice Arena. It's the best way to sneak in a little practise before you head into the stadiums for real.

Keep an eye on the stats of your players, too. Agility, Ball Control, and Dribbling are all attributes detailed on your players' stats, and the higher these attributes are rated, the better they are at Agile Dribbling. Prioritise recruiting at least a couple of players with good DRI stats to boost your team's ability to retain the ball.
